Fitting Set, Add On System, for Sliding Interior Doors, Hawa-Telescopic 40/4 (Part No: 940.41.002) is a heavy duty sliding & folding door hardware solution designed for smooth, reliable performance in demanding spaces. If you’re installing a multi-panel folding or sliding system, this top hung set helps you achieve a clean, space-saving operation with professional results.
Top hung system, for 4 doors, the Telescopic 40/4 model is built to handle up to 40 kg per door and supports large door dimensions—making it ideal for both residential upgrades and commercial applications. With a door width of 500–800 mm and a maximum door height of up to 4,000 mm, it offers versatility for modern interior designs.
Designed specifically for wood doors, this set is suitable for Hawa-Junior 40 and accommodates 4 door leaves per set. Door thickness compatibility ranges from 40–47 mm, helping you fit the system confidently without unnecessary adjustments.
For added convenience during installation, the system includes further adjustment facility with door height adjustability, and it uses ceiling installation for a neat, overhead-running layout.
Order reference note: Please order 4 Hawa-Junior 80/Z sets separately. Also, running tracks must be ordered separately.
